Ray Gallon

Candidate for Director

Ray is an independent consultant specializing in the convergence of content strategy, content development, and usability. He is currently in his second term as president of STC France. Before that, he was the chapter’s education outreach manager, and guided STC France’s mentoring programme. Internationally, Ray has served two years on STC’s Community Affairs Committee (CAC), focusing on outreach to non-North American chapters. He also served as CAC representative on the Globalization Audit Task Force, and this year he is CAC communications lead. His candidacy is based on renewing STC through a strong international presence to influence the development of our profession, an enhanced role for STC communities, and providing real value and service to members.
